Superman 16 May 2021 13:04

It works very well. One bug I found though is that on exit back to the workbench the display stays as NTSC even though WB prefs says PAL. I have to reboot to get it back.

jotd 16 May 2021 16:03

probably some rogue write to beamcon register (and also whdload not restoring pal properly). Fixable.

Superman 16 May 2021 17:12

Yes indeed. Turbo Sprint had the same issue initially which was quickly resolved by Stingray. :great

StingRay 17 May 2021 11:58

Quote:

Originally Posted by redblade (Post 1484231)
Can you explain this a bit more please?


WHDLoad can't restore the display settings properly if the BEAMCON0 register has been changed. Any write to BEAMCON0 needs to be disabled/emulated in the slave code.

Ok so the BEAMCON0 is not in the system copperlist, so when the system copperlist gets reinstalled it still uses the BEAMCON0 from the game, got it.
Is this the same type of bug with the mouse pointer when you exit from a demo when using a 31khz screen mode and it displays a different size mouse pointer?

jotd 17 May 2021 23:23

looks very much like it yes. Not the same register though. It's more related to sprite resolution control register

some custom registers are in copperlists, some aren't. Depends on the copperlist. I recently read that writing to registers during copperlists steals cycles to the blitter so better write only the ones that you need...
